The weather in South Yarmouth can cause big changes in barometric pressure, which can be high, low, or steady. These changes can make the weather sunny, rainy, or stormy.
South Yarmouth is close to sea level and near the ocean, which can make atmospheric pressure change quickly. The town's flat landscape also helps pressure systems move through quickly.
In winter, pressure is usually low, bringing cold air and storms. In summer, pressure is usually high, bringing warm air and clear skies. Spring and fall bring changing pressure and mixed weather.
South Yarmouth has a humid continental climate, which means big pressure changes can bring big weather changes, making the weather exciting but sometimes unpredictable.
